#c2b6b1 color RGB value is (194,182,177). #c2b6b1 color name is Custom Color color.

#c2b6b1 hex color red value is 194, green value is 182 and the blue value of its RGB is 177.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#c2b6b1 hue: 0.05, saturation: 0.12 and the lightness value of c2b6b1 is 0.73.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#c2b6b1 color hex is 0.00, 0.06, 0.09, 0.24. Web safe color of #c2b6b1 is #cccc99. Color #c2b6b1 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#C2B6B1 Custom Color

#C2B6B1 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 194, 182, 177.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#c2b6b1,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#c2b6b1 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#c2b6b1), RGB (rgb(194, 182, 177)), HSL (hsl(18, 12%, 73%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ccc99,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
